Pumpkin Patch School Tours

Lee Farms offers a school tour that kids will be sure to remember. Our tours are not only fun, but are also educational teaching all sorts of things about how farms are important in society all the way to how a pumpkin is grown.

Our tour includes...

  • Pumpkin Theater: "Pumpkins are Like People".
  • Cider press demonstration and sample for everyone.
  • Farm animal petting zoo.
  • Haymaze!!! Designed for children six and under.
  • Hayride  

Each child will receive...

  • Pumpkin
  • Educational coloring book
  • Pumpkin patch sticker
  • Apple cider sample

Each certified teacher will receive...

  • A jar of our famous Marionberry jam.
  • A $10 gift certificate redeemable at our country store.

Each group will be accompanied by one of our friendly & knowledgeable farm guides. Our tour provides students with firsthand knowledge of farming with special emphasis on what's going on at the farm & tying it in to the school curriculum appropriate for your class. Your students will also enjoy some down-on-the-farm fun. Our school tours start during the late part of September and continue throughout the month of October.

All tours are priced per person; chaperones and family are included however class teachers are free. Everyone who goes on the tour will be able to fully participate and receive all parts included in the tour. Through our many years of experience, we have found the tours run more efficiently by allowing parents/chaperones and siblings to share in all of the activities of the tour instead of trying to separate them from their children.

As times fill up throughout the season all tours must be scheduled in advance. Tours run throughout the week during the school day. All groups are asked to select time slots that are applicable to their schedules. Timing is essential in providing the superior service to all our special visitors. Any conflicts in scheduling will seriously affect the tours that follow and we offer the same courtesy and consideration to all groups so we ask that you make sure to be on time for your tour. Tours last approximately 40 - 60 minutes and are always lead by one of our friendly staff to ensure nothing is missed out on.

We start scheduling fall group tours in the beginning of July. To ensure you are able to get the time slot you want we suggest you sign up early as popular time slots due fill up fast. Tours are priced differently throughout the month of October with the cheapest time slots at the beginning of the month and the most expensive towards the end.
